Get the Size Right

A bangle that does not fit comfortably will rarely become a favorite.
If it is too tight, it can feel uncomfortable when she moves her wrist. If it is too loose, it may slide around, catch on clothing, or fall off while she is going about her day.
Before buying, check:
-
Her existing bangle size, if you can do so discreetly.
-
The brand’s size chart.
-
Whether the bangle is open, closed, or adjustable.
-
The width of the design, since wider bangles may need a more comfortable fit.
If you are choosing a closed bangle, the measurement needs to pass comfortably over the widest part of the hand. If you are buying an open or adjustable design, the wrist measurement becomes more important.
When in doubt, an adjustable bangle can make gifting easier without sacrificing style.
Look for Genuine Silver
A bangle may look beautiful in a photograph, but the material determines how it performs over time.
Look for clear information about 925 sterling silver instead of vague phrases such as “silver finish” or “premium quality.” Genuine sterling silver is made with 92.5% silver, with additional alloy used to improve strength for jewelry-making.

Pay Attention to the Finish
Bangles move constantly.
They rub against clothing, tables, bags, watches, and other jewelry. That means the finish needs to be smooth and the construction needs to be reliable.
Before buying, look closely at:
-
Smooth inner and outer edges.
-
An even surface without rough patches.
-
Clean patterns and well-defined details.
-
Secure joints on open or adjustable designs.
-
A finish that looks consistent from every angle.
Run your eyes over the areas that will touch the skin. A beautiful design is not enough if the edges feel sharp or uncomfortable.

How to Care for Silver Bangles

Silver can tarnish naturally when exposed to air, moisture, body oils, and chemicals. This is normal and does not automatically mean the piece is fake.
A few simple habits can help maintain its appearance:
-
Remove bangles before showering, swimming, exercising, or doing household work.
-
Apply perfume, lotion, and hairspray before putting on your jewelry.
-
Wipe the bangle gently with a soft cloth after wearing it.
-
Store it in a dry pouch or closed jewelry box.
-
Keep it separate from pieces that may scratch the surface.
When it comes to polishing silver jewelry, use a soft silver polishing cloth and gentle movements. Avoid rough materials, aggressive scrubbing, or strong cleaners, especially on gold-plated finishes. Gold plating can wear down with repeated friction, so a gold plated silver bangle needs more delicate care.
The best care routine is simple care done regularly.
